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 6 and 8 is 24
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 24 - For the 1st fraction, since 6 × 4 = 24,
50/6 = 50 × 4/6 × 4 = 200/24 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 8 × 3 = 24,
5/8 = 5 × 3/8 × 3 = 15/24 - Add the two like fractions:
200/24 + 15/24 = 200 + 15/24 = 215/24 - So, 50/6 + 5/8 = 215/24
